From cfe94f82e2f1134d307ab8b1de264ef4420e450d Mon Sep 17 00:00:00 2001 From: Olivier Fourdan <fourdan.olivier@wanadoo.fr> Date: Wed, 12 May 2004 20:06:54 +0000 Subject: [PATCH] Change revert to RevertToPointerRoot in XSetInputFocus() (Old svn revision: 11750) --- po/xfwm4.pot | 4 ++-- src/focus.c | 4 ++-- src/main.c | 2 +- 3 files changed, 5 insertions(+), 5 deletions(-) diff --git a/po/xfwm4.pot b/po/xfwm4.pot index 822ee4d77..53267439d 100644 --- a/po/xfwm4.pot +++ b/po/xfwm4.pot @@ -8,7 +8,7 @@ msgid "" msgstr "" "Project-Id-Version: PACKAGE VERSION\n" "Report-Msgid-Bugs-To: \n" -"POT-Creation-Date: 2004-05-11 07:48+0200\n" +"POT-Creation-Date: 2004-05-12 10:32+0200\n" "PO-Revision-Date: YEAR-MO-DA HO:MI+ZONE\n" "Last-Translator: FULL NAME <EMAIL@ADDRESS>\n" "Language-Team: LANGUAGE <LL@li.org>\n" @@ -413,7 +413,7 @@ msgstr "" msgid "%s: GtkMenu failed to grab the pointer\n" msgstr "" -#: src/netwm.c:220 +#: src/netwm.c:221 #, c-format msgid "%s: Unmanaged net_wm_state (window 0x%lx)" msgstr "" diff --git a/src/focus.c b/src/focus.c index 2d0090668..bc6be4313 100644 --- a/src/focus.c +++ b/src/focus.c @@ -450,7 +450,7 @@ clientSetFocus (Client * c, unsigned short flags) if (FLAG_TEST (c->wm_flags, WM_FLAG_INPUT)) { pending_focus = c; - XSetInputFocus (dpy, c->window, RevertToNone, CurrentTime); + XSetInputFocus (dpy, c->window, RevertToPointerRoot, CurrentTime); } if (FLAG_TEST(c->wm_flags, WM_FLAG_TAKEFOCUS)) { @@ -469,7 +469,7 @@ clientSetFocus (Client * c, unsigned short flags) { frameDraw (c2, FALSE, FALSE); } - XSetInputFocus (dpy, gnome_win, RevertToNone, CurrentTime); + XSetInputFocus (dpy, gnome_win, RevertToPointerRoot, CurrentTime); XFlush (dpy); data[0] = data[1] = None; XChangeProperty (dpy, root, net_active_window, XA_WINDOW, 32, diff --git a/src/main.c b/src/main.c index 687baf9bd..d455be8a6 100644 --- a/src/main.c +++ b/src/main.c @@ -361,7 +361,7 @@ initialize (int argc, char **argv) workspaceUpdateArea (margins, gnome_margins); initNetDesktopParams (dpy, screen, workspace); setNetWorkarea (dpy, screen, params.workspace_count, margins); - XSetInputFocus (dpy, gnome_win, RevertToNone, CurrentTime); + XSetInputFocus (dpy, gnome_win, RevertToPointerRoot, CurrentTime); initGtkCallbacks (); /* The first time the first Gtk application on a display uses pango, -- GitLab